Education: Color Matters

The electromagnetic spectrum forms the basis of color perception. It isn't an inherent characteristic or property of the material. Instead, it is a phenomenon that is affected by a number of elements. This includes reflections, absorption, and light interference spectrums.

Learning is affected by color

Color has a significant influence on the attention of a student and performance. Even though it may not be apparent, the link is evident. The learners' needs should determine the color scheme that is employed in the classroom.

Research into the effects that of color on learning is increasing. These studies focus on various aspects of color, including its ability affect emotion, focus and retention.

Recent research has examined the cognitive abilities of students in achromatic and color learning environments. The results show that colors affect students differently depending on gender and their age. Furthermore, students who have a higher cognitive capacity could experience more complicated impacts.
